LEVEL OF SERVICES

Each student may select the level of service that best meets their unique learning needs. Each level of service has a specific fee which is added to the student’s Muskingum University bill and may be calculated into the student’s financial need.

Within the time level selected students will receive the supports that best meet their unique learning needs which may include executive functioning, academic tutoring, conflict resolution, social navigation, small group tutoring, structured study, etc. 

Updated Levels (as of Fall 2026)

PLUS Level 5 – Maximum of 5 hours of scheduled individualized support

PLUS Level 4 – Maximum of 4 hours of scheduled individualized support 

PLUS Level 3 – Maximum of 3 hours of scheduled individualized support 

PLUS Level 2 – Maximum of 2 hours of scheduled individualized support 

PLUS Level 1 – Maximum of 1 hour of scheduled individualized support

EXECUTIVE FUNCTIONING SKILLS

Executive functioning skills are the mental processes that enable students to successfully manage themselves and their resources to achieve a goal.

  • Self-control – regulate emotions and control behavior during stressful situations
  • Working memory – manage multiple and complex tasks
  • Cognitive flexibility – adapt to new tasks quickly

Since executive functioning skills can be challenging for many students with learning differences, Learning Specialists work with each student to develop skills essential for success in college and life beyond college.

  • Stress management
  • Problem-solving
  • Time management
  • Organizational skills
  • Planning for multiple or large tasks
  • Memory strategies

LEAP

For students wanting to get an early start on their transition to college, the PLUS Program offers LEAP. 

Students registered in LEAP will start their freshman fall semester two-weeks early using a blended format to explore the technology, the expectations of a college course, moving to campus a week early, learning to navigate the campus, and much more.
